    NEW Proboat Thundercat 31 (TC31) Replacement Hull with some mods

    Brand new Pro Boat Thundercat 31 (TC31) replacement hull.

    Hull is brand new, but has had some of the inner wood removed in the motor-mount area to begin an FE conversion. Transom was drilled up to accommodate a pair of Outboards, and stuffing tube was cut out.

    Great project hull to do a twin conversion, or ???

    These are great quality hulls that are basically a "snapshot" of the Cheetah or Mean Machine style bottoms. Boats are fast and handle really well.

    Package does include the original Nitro style radio/servo box and accessories.
